Changelog — Tracewick Diagram Editor v3.2: Undo/Redo defaults changed

We changed the default undo/redo behavior for new team members to be aware of. Previously, the history stack was capped at 50 steps and grouped rapid edits into single entries using a 300 ms window. The cap is now 200 steps, grouping is off by default, and redo history survives autosave. Existing workspaces keep their old settings unless reset. If you reset a workspace, the editor will pick up the new defaults, which are.

deployment values, yahag-tawef:
ZORWYN_HOST=zorwyn.tolvaqlabs.internal
ZORWYN_PORT=9300

Welcome to the Lanternleaf consent banner program. Plugin authors must register each banner variant before rollout so the Driftgate compliance checker can validate copy, locale coverage, and dismissal behavior. Please test against the staging consent ledger rather than production; consent records are immutable once written, and malformed entries cannot be purged without a formal review. To connect your local plugin harness to the staging ledger, configure your client with the connection string below.

replica DSN, hadug-yajep: postgresql://aldiel_svc:W4u8z42Jo5IFtG@db-1656.torvacorp.local:5432/holael

# Nightly reindex config for Pondglass search — quick notes for the sync:
# we moved the full reindex to 02:30 because the old slot kept colliding
# with the Ferrow batch exports and half the shards came up cold. Batch
# size is now 500 docs, retries capped at 3. The indexer still needs its
# write credential, which goes right here below.

vault entry, yajop-bafop: ARCHIVE_KEY3=8d4